Our precious baby, born on October 4, 2024, in Arlington, Texas, Jayce Ryan brought joy and love into the world. On October 22, 2025, our little fighter passed away, gaining his angel wings and leaving behind a legacy of happiness and affection in his short but impactful life.
Jayce had the cutest chubby cheeks, he was a sweet, happy, and loving baby who always had a smile on his face. He loved to snuggle, be close to and look at his mommy Derrionna, who was truly his whole world. Jayce also loved being talked to and sung to, enjoyed sucking on his tongue, and was fascinated by his reflection in the mirror. Handsome and full of sass, yet incredibly sweet, Jayce had a personality that charmed everyone he met. He was, in every sense, an amazing baby.
Jayce is deeply missed by his mother, Derrionna; his father, Dijon; his sister, Raeleigh, age four; his brother, Leighton, age three; his beloved grandmother, Nuna and family. His hobbies included tummy time, looking in the mirror, and engaging with anyone and everyone around him. The funeral service will be held on November 5th at 10am at Wade Family Funeral Home.
